首页 > 科技 >

数据结构与算法(C语言版)__顺序查找_c语言数据结构顺序查找算法

发布时间:2025-03-03 19:18:55来源:

👩‍💻在编程的世界里,掌握数据结构和算法是至关重要的技能之一。今天,让我们一起探讨一种基础但又十分实用的数据结构——顺序查找(Sequential Search)!🔍

📚 顺序查找是一种简单直观的搜索方法,它适用于任何类型的一维数组,无论数组是否有序。它的基本思想是从数组的第一个元素开始,依次检查每个元素是否满足条件,直到找到目标元素或遍历完整个数组为止。

🛠️ 在C语言中实现顺序查找非常直接。首先定义一个函数,接收一个整型数组和要查找的目标值作为参数。然后使用一个循环从数组的第一个元素开始逐一比较,如果找到了目标值,就返回该元素的位置;如果没有找到,则返回一个特殊值(如-1)表示未找到。

🎯 例如,假设我们有一个整型数组arr[] = {5, 3, 9, 7, 1},我们要查找数字9。通过顺序查找算法,我们可以轻松地定位到9的位置(索引为2)。这是一种非常适合初学者理解和实践的方法!

🚀 掌握顺序查找不仅能够帮助你更好地理解数据结构的基础概念,还能为学习更复杂的算法打下坚实的基础。希望这篇简短的介绍对你有所帮助,快去动手试试吧!👨‍💻

数据结构 算法 C语言

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。